So if you want txt and mp3 files to have tags, you have to program the tagging mechanism first. The xml tag files matching mkvmerges dtd format for all the examples on this page can be found in a zip file. To ensure that information in the indesign file changes automatically whenever the xml file is updated, you can create a link to the xml file in indesign. Tags, which corresponds to keywords in the pdf file. Xml elements can be defined as building blocks of an xml. Net framework use xml files for configuration, and property lists are an. Each xml document contains one or more elements, the scope of which are either delimited by start and end tags, or for empty elements, by an emptyelement tag.
How to decode a base64string in xml to be a pdf file. Cdata is used to ignore special characters when parsing xml documents. I think we can not examine the html tags in pdf, so i think that first of all we should parse whole pdf,then convert it into the xml. The editor inserts a comment end tag and places the cursor between the start and end comment tags. The info dictionary or info dict has been included in pdf since version 1. It is a handy tool for converting xml to word, pdf to word, pdf to excel, and has a range of other document conversion features. Pdf metadata how to add, use or edit metadata in pdf files. A well formed xml document is not the same as a valid xml document. It no longer is a pdf form, its xml in a pdf wrapper even if you remove all the form fields. In fact, using the details pane is one of the easiest ways to tag files in windows. There are two different document type definitions that can be used with xml. One alternative might to read the target xml file as a flat file source in a second mapping each input line is one single long input field. For training, we will need to know which pdf elements correspond to which xml tags.
As html contains tags similar to xml, so when you write html inside any xml tag, the parser treats it as xml markups and they simply cannot be recognized as xml tags. Xfa is short for xml forms architecture, a family of proprietary xml specifications. Generate pdf from xml using xslt seeroo it solutions. With a huge amount of data it is more difficult to identify the information we needed. Each pdf file encapsulates a complete description of a fixedlayout flat document, including the text, fonts, graphics, and other information needed to display it. Html works with predefined tags like p tag, h1 tag, etc. Xml documents can contain international characters, like norwegian o. To avoid errors, you should specify the encoding used, or save your xml files as utf8.
Once the conversion finishes, click the download or download all zip archive of all files to download your pdf files. Occurrences this determines if an element is optional or mandatory, and how many times the element can be repeated. Xml tags label text and other content in a file so that applications can. Remove all the html tags and display a plain text only. This is a video tutorial on working with xml files in visual basic visual studio 2010.
A really, really, really good introduction to xml sitepoint. I took the render xml in a browser route cause this was the most easily20 explainedunderstood. Xml tag short name to identify an element within a xml message, presented between brackets, e. For example, a pdf can have xml tags that came in from an xml schema. The xml certificate documents your knowledge of xml, xml dom and xslt. I am working on a linux shell script to find information in a xml file using grep. The beginning of every nonempty xml element is marked by a starttag. Extensible markup language xml is a markup language that defines a set of rules for. In addition, all instances created from a given xfa form template keep the. You might be able to print to pdf from acrobat to make a new, nonform, flat pdf. I need php code to parse any pdf file and convert it into the xml format. Working with xml files part 1 writing to xml visual basic.
Sciencebeam using computer vision to extract pdf data. It is equally employed for creating, opening, and saving pdf files. Is the content ascii text, an xml snippet, or a binary file, like a pdf or. What i actually want to do is send an email from20 unix. Prince supports tagged pdf files and optional pdf profiles, which can be. They can also be used to insert comments, declare settings required for parsing the environment, and to insert special instructions. Xml tags are not as predefined as html, but we can define our own user tags for simplicity. The xml files contain the correct tagging for the whole document. Pdf to xml is a program that converts adobe pdf documents into xml format. In adobe acrobat, you can access this internal file metadata by going to file properties or pressing ctrld commandd on mac. Adobe xml forms architecture xfa forms, introduced in the pdf 1. For more information, see writing livecycle form output to an xdp file in extracting data from a pdf form submission.
In the case of computer vision, we will also need the exact coordinates. Create pdf from extensible markup language xml files. Prince produces pdf files that are compatible with adobe acrobat and other pdf. The portable document format pdf is a file format used to present documents in a manner independent of application software, hardware, and operating systems.
Objects, an xml language for rendering xml documents, often used to generate pdfs. Utf8 is the default character encoding for xml documents. Introduction to xml how to learn using oreilly school of technology courses setting xml mode what is xml. Xml is also known as extensible markup language which is one of the markup languages used for the world wide web. An xml parser is a program that translates xml an xml document into a dom treestructure like document. Remove all the html tags and display a plain text only inside in case xml is not well formed hiren solanki.
Tagged pdf is not required in situations where a pdf file is intended only for print. It becomes much more flexible for professionals when you convert xml to pdf file format. Before you can tag your documents or import and export xml, install the xmedia ui plugin file. Erweiterbare auszeichnungssprache, abgekurzt xml, ist. Follow these steps in adobe acrobat pro to view and edit tags, add alternate text. When the xml file is validated against the document type definitiondtd, then it is called valid xml. Edit document structure with the content and tags panels adobe. Tag files from details pane windows 10 alternatively, you can also add file tags via the details pane. For this to work in unix mail program, i probably have to pass in a20. Xml verwendet tags, um teile einer datei wie beispielsweise eine uberschrift oder einen. This conversion tool supports conversion of xml files such as. What i want is, if the pdf document contains table, i want table fields as xml tag and table data as a values.
The details pane shows relevant information about any selected file, folder, or drive. Although it would be cool if the os did it natively. I need to know if there is any way to include any attribute within the tags in my. Xml employs tags to describe parts of a filea heading or a story, for example. If you want to insert an empty page at the end of the pdf file, you only need to call add method of the pages collection of document object, without any parameters. The bi publisher pdf mapping functionality enables you to match existing form fields in a pdf template with sample data field tags. Indesign xml workflows allow for close control over a documents graphical elements and enable you to automate almost any kind of layout. Xml extensible markup language is a way to repurpose data in a file or automate the process of replacing the data in one file with data from another file.
Remove xfa tag from pdf file by pdf toolbox command line. How to decode a base64string in xml to be a pdf file i came across a situation where we have an xml node that has been encoded as base64. In this article, well cover how to convert xml to pdf with pdfelement. It contains general information about a pdf file using a set of document info entries, simple pairs of data that consist of a key and a matching value. Therefore as the first step we need to use the xml to annotate the pdf elements at individual character level. How to find information inside a xml tag using grep.
Display the xml file display the xml file as a note. The tags in the example below are not defined in any xml standard. Isnt that what the old winfs file system was supposed to do, but it never saw the light of day. The cdata section contains text which is not parsed. The only way to solve this problem is to convert xml data to a.
Pdfelement is the perfect software for people that work with these file types mentioned above and those that seek an affordable editing suite. In computing, extensible markup language xml is a markup language that defines a set of rules for encoding documents in a format that is both humanreadable and machinereadable. Instead of applying formatting paragraph by paragraph, you define the look and feel and associate xml tags with formatting. These tags are invented by the author of the xml document. Author, which corresponds to author in the pdf file. Xfas main extension to xml are computationally active tags. I need to parse a pdf file and convert whole text into xml.
I needed to get that string out of my xml and save it to a pdf file. When you remove xfa tag from pdf form, interactive pdf form will turn to normal pdf file. If only one language is required, choose the language with file. An xml coding scheme for multimodal corpus annotation. Sie konnen xml ahnliche tags hinzufugen, um einem pdf eine struktur zu geben. Xml encoding is used to avoid errors and xml files have to be saved as unicode. Net offers a very simple method to read xml data and render it in pdf files. First, you need to create a document object with the input pdf file in which you want to add the blank page. While in xml, the author must define both the tags and the document structure. Subject, which corresponds to description in the pdf file.
The issue can be overcome by using cdata section in xml. Notepad is a simple application designed for text files and also has xml support and editing possibilities. The most recognizable feature of xml is its tags, or elements to be. This article, along with any associated source code and files, is licensed under the code project open license cpol share. Parsing xml a basic xml document differences between xml and html common mistakes white space closing tags nesting tags root element capitalization quoting. For forms created in livecycle, you have the option to write the output to an xml data package xdp file rather than a pdf file. In your downloaded zip file, you will find a sample xml file, an idml template, and the final document in pdf and indesign format, complete with images and fonts.